Html 渐变背景CSS页面的全高
我有一个网站,它使用的梯度如下:Html 渐变背景CSS页面的全高,html,css,gradient,Html,Css,Gradient,我有一个网站,它使用的梯度如下: #grad { background: -webkit-linear-gradient(#87a0b4 80%, #6b88a1); background: -o-linear-gradient(#87a0b4 80%, #6b88a1); background: -moz-linear-gradient(#87a0b4 80%, #6b88a1); background: linear-gradient(#87a0b4 80%,
#grad {
background: -webkit-linear-gradient(#87a0b4 80%, #6b88a1);
background: -o-linear-gradient(#87a0b4 80%, #6b88a1);
background: -moz-linear-gradient(#87a0b4 80%, #6b88a1);
background: linear-gradient(#87a0b4 80%, #6b88a1);
}
<body id="grad">
#梯度{
背景:-webkit线性梯度(#87a0b4 80%,#6b88a1);
背景:-o-线性梯度(#87a0b4 80%,#6b88a1);
背景:-moz线性梯度(#87a0b4 80%,#6b88a1);
背景:线性梯度(#87a0b4 80%,#6b88a1);
}
我遇到的问题是,如果页面恰好拉伸到比我的标准窗口更高的位置(我确信这在不同的屏幕上会有所不同),梯度就会重置
这里可以看到问题:
我如何解决这个问题,使渐变始终在底部结束,而不管页面结束多长时间?只需使用
background-attachement: fixed;
简单使用
background-attachement: fixed;
简单使用
background-attachement: fixed;
简单使用
background-attachement: fixed;
尝试将
背景附件:固定和高度:100%
添加到您的#grad尝试将背景附件:固定和高度:100%
添加到您的#grad尝试将背景附件:固定和高度:100%
添加到您的#grad
尝试将背景附件:fixed
和高度:100%
添加到您的#grad替换您的容器类,该类现在看起来如下:
.container {
width: 980px;
height: 1000px;
}
为此
.container {
width: 980px;
height: 100%;
}
只需更改高度以填充100%即可替换容器类,该类现在看起来如下所示:
.container {
width: 980px;
height: 1000px;
}
为此
.container {
width: 980px;
height: 100%;
}
只需更改高度以填充100%即可替换容器类,该类现在看起来如下所示:
.container {
width: 980px;
height: 1000px;
}
为此
.container {
width: 980px;
height: 100%;
}
只需更改高度以填充100%即可替换容器类,该类现在看起来如下所示:
.container {
width: 980px;
height: 1000px;
}
为此
.container {
width: 980px;
height: 100%;
}
只需更改高度以填充100%请包含足够的代码以重现错误,而不是指向您站点的链接。我包含的代码是用于渐变的所有代码。错误不能仅通过该代码片段重现,因此您需要提供更多代码。我添加了此代码,请查看重现的含义;如果您只有您提供的代码,那么代码当然会正常工作。问题是,您没有提供足够的代码让我们在您的情况下看到这一点。今后,请至少提供准确再现错误所需的最少代码,最好是使用JSFIDLE或类似链接。请包含足够的代码来再现错误,而不是指向您站点的链接。我包含的代码是用于梯度的所有代码。仅此代码片段无法再现错误,所以你需要提供更多的代码。我加了这个请查一下是什么意思;如果您只有您提供的代码,那么代码当然会正常工作。问题是,您没有提供足够的代码让我们在您的情况下看到这一点。今后,请至少提供准确再现错误所需的最少代码,最好是使用JSFIDLE或类似链接。请包含足够的代码来再现错误,而不是指向您站点的链接。我包含的代码是用于梯度的所有代码。仅此代码片段无法再现错误,所以你需要提供更多的代码。我加了这个请查一下是什么意思;如果您只有您提供的代码,那么代码当然会正常工作。问题是,您没有提供足够的代码让我们在您的情况下看到这一点。今后,请至少提供准确再现错误所需的最少代码,最好是使用JSFIDLE或类似链接。请包含足够的代码来再现错误,而不是指向您站点的链接。我包含的代码是用于梯度的所有代码。仅此代码片段无法再现错误,所以你需要提供更多的代码。我加了这个请查一下是什么意思;如果您只有您提供的代码,那么代码当然会正常工作。问题是,您没有提供足够的代码让我们在您的情况下看到这一点。在将来,请至少提供准确再现错误所需的最少代码,最好使用JSFIDLE或类似链接。感谢您的回复,我添加了两行代码,结果是相同的。请尝试并提供更大的代码示例,可能尝试JSFIDLE,以便我们可以处理它。当我在你的live站点上用Firebug进行编辑时,如果我应用了两个CSS修复,我就无法重现这个问题。没问题。很高兴你修好了!感谢您的回复,我添加了这两行代码,结果是相同的请尝试并提供更大的代码示例,也许可以尝试JSFIDLE,以便我们可以使用它。当我在你的live站点上用Firebug进行编辑时,如果我应用了两个CSS修复,我就无法重现这个问题。没问题。很高兴你修好了!感谢您的回复,我添加了这两行代码,结果是相同的请尝试并提供更大的代码示例,也许可以尝试JSFIDLE,以便我们可以使用它。当我在你的live站点上用Firebug进行编辑时,如果我应用了两个CSS修复,我就无法重现这个问题。没问题。很高兴你修好了!感谢您的回复,我添加了这两行代码,结果是相同的请尝试并提供更大的代码示例,也许可以尝试JSFIDLE,以便我们可以使用它。当我在你的live站点上用Firebug进行编辑时,如果我应用了两个CSS修复,我就无法重现这个问题。没问题。很高兴你修好了!